Where are Highways being built in BiH: They will reduce the Distance between Cities

Published July 31, 2023
Share
SHARE

”Since Corridor 5C does not pass through all parts of the country, the commitment of the Government of the Federation of Bosnia and Herzegovina (FBiH) and Public Utility Autoceste(Motorways) of FBiH is to build highways throughout the Federation in order to enable the even infrastructural development of all cantons, and to make them even more attractive to attract both domestic and foreign investments, ” it was said from Motorways of FBiH.

Financing of expressways in FBiH is done from the Budget of the FBiH. Every year, the FBiH Government adopts the Decision on the adoption of the program for spending part of the funds “Capital transfers to public companies – transfer for the construction of highways and express roads“, determined by the FBiH Budget.

The funds are intended for financing the costs of design, expropriation, works and supervision.

Express roads in the FBiH are:

Bihac – Cazin – Velika Kladusa – Border with the Republic of Croatia;

Bihac – Kljuc;

Lasva – Travnik – Jajce;

Praca – Gorazde;

Mostar – Siroki Brijeg – border with the Republic of Croatia.

Contracts for the execution of works were signed for the Praca – Gorazde (Hranjen Tunnel) and Lasva – Travnik – Jajce expressways, the Lasva – Nevic Polje section (LOT 5 exit from the Vitez – Nevic Polje business zone), and the last section of the Sarajevo bypass from Vlakovo to Mostar intersection – LOT 3B.

Other sections are in the phase of preparation for construction.

Hranjen tunnel

More than 50% of the main and service tunnel pipes have been breached

The Hranjen tunnel with a total length of 5.5 kilometers, which is under construction, is an integral part of the 18.5 kilometer long Praca – Gorazde expressway project (Hrenovica – Hranjen – Gorazde), which will connect Sarajevo and Gorazde. The construction of the Hranjen tunnel represents a historic project for Gorazde, as the road distance between this city on the Drina and Sarajevo will be reduced from the current 95.6 to 56 kilometers.

The contractor is Euro-asfalt d.o.o. Sarajevo, and the supervision of the works is carried out by IPSA Institute d.o.o. Sarajevo.

Lasva – Nevic Polje, LOT 5

Express road through central Bosnia

In the area of the Central Bosnian Canton, the construction of one part of the section of the expressway Lasva – Nevic Polje, LOT 5, with a length of 4.8 kilometers, is underway. The other four LOTs of this section are Lasva – Kaonik, Kaonik – Seliste, Seliste Vitez (Vitez interchange – entrance to the business zone), and Poslovna zona Vitez (Vitez interchange – from the entrance to the exit of the Business Zone). The future road Lasva – NevicPolje will have a total length of 24.3 kilometers.

LOT 5 is designed as a road with the characteristics of an expressway with two traffic lanes (driving and overtaking) for each direction of movement.

Sarajevo bypass – LOT 3B

Activities undertaken with the aim of continuing and completing construction

The route of the expressway LOT 3B is the connection of the Vlakovo interchange with the interchange at the Mostar intersection to the main road M-17/M-5, with a total length of 1.44 kilometers.

The construction of LOT 3B will enable a better traffic connection of the highway on Corridor Vc with the network of lower-level roads, main and local roads. More specifically, a direct connection will be provided for vehicles coming towards the Vlakovo interchange on the highway from the roundabout at the Mostar intersection, i.e. from the direction of Kiseljak, Rakovica, Pazaric and Hadzici, Biznis Info reports.
